| /**
|
| + * A message object passed to the debug message handler.
|
| + */
|
| + class Message {
|
| + public:
|
| + /**
|
| + * Check type of message.
|
| + */
|
| + virtual bool IsEvent() const = 0;
|
| + virtual bool IsResponse() const = 0;
|
| + virtual DebugEvent GetEvent() const = 0;
|
| +
|
| + /**
|
| + * Indicate whether this is a response to a continue command which will
|
| + * start the VM running after this is processed.
|
| + */
|
| + virtual bool WillStartRunning() const = 0;
|
| +
|
| + /**
|
| + * Access to execution state and event data. Don't store these cross
|
| + * callbacks as their content becomes invalid. These objects are from the
|
| + * debugger event that started the debug message loop.
|
| + */
|
| + virtual Handle<Object> GetExecutionState() const = 0;
|
| + virtual Handle<Object> GetEventData() const = 0;
|
| +
|
| + /**
|
| + * Get the debugger protocol JSON.
|
| + */
|
| + virtual Handle<String> GetJSON() const = 0;
|
| +
|
| + /**
|
| + * Get the context active when the debug event happened. Note this is not
|
| + * the current active context as the JavaScript part of the debugger is
|
| + * running in it's own context which is entered at this point.
|
| + */
|
| + virtual Handle<Context> GetEventContext() const = 0;
|
| +
|
| + /**
|
| + * Client data passed with the corresponding request if any. This is the
|
| + * client_data data value passed into Debug::SendCommand along with the
|
| + * request that led to the message or NULL if the message is an event. The
|
| + * debugger takes ownership of the data and will delete it even if there is
|
| + * no message handler.
|
| + */
|
| + virtual ClientData* GetClientData() const = 0;
|
| + };
